Drilled shafts in rock are widely used as foundations for heavy structures such as highway bridges and tall buildings. This book presents methods for characterizing discontinuities in jointed rock masses and considers their effects on the behavior of drilled shafts. It serves as a valuable tool for practitioners in geological engineering, rock mechanics, and foundation engineering.
